Output 908467661eb833aeb8310cbd3936c7719d5ada97b5b8121e281a3e76d950d1ea:1

value
23115770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a19f4d242b2a6d5bc075968523320a3a4679c40 OP_EQUAL
address
3452b1UXrUK3YaVB4Peojj6EYCMYcxSf85
transaction
908467661eb833aeb8310cbd3936c7719d5ada97b5b8121e281a3e76d950d1ea
spent
true